Hotel Painting in Waco, TX
Hotel painting services encompass interior and exterior painting projects tailored to enhance the appearance and durability of hospitality properties. These services typically include refreshing guest rooms, common areas, hallways, and exterior facades, ensuring a welcoming environment for visitors. Property owners often request hotel painting to update outdated colors, improve curb appeal, or prepare the building for new branding or renovations. Before requesting these services, it’s helpful to understand the scope of work needed, the types of finishes desired, and any specific requirements related to surface preparation or paint durability, especially in high-traffic or moisture-prone areas.
When considering hotel painting projects, property owners usually want clarity on the materials used, surface preparation processes, and the expected outcomes. They may inquire about the best types of paints for high-traffic zones, the impact of weather conditions on exterior work, or the need for minimal disruption during ongoing operations. Understanding these factors can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s aesthetic goals and functional needs, resulting in a professional and long-lasting finish that enhances the overall guest experience.

Hotel Painting Questions
What types of surfaces can be painted inside a hotel? Interior walls, ceilings, doors, trim, and other architectural features can be painted to enhance the appearance and protect surfaces.
Are special paints needed for hotel interiors? Yes, durable and washable paints are typically used to withstand frequent cleaning and high traffic areas.
Can hotel painting include decorative finishes? Yes, decorative techniques such as faux finishes, murals, or accent walls can be added to create a unique ambiance.
What should property owners consider before starting a hotel painting project? It's important to prepare surfaces properly, select appropriate paints, and plan for minimal disruption to guests or operations.
